The HPP3 isn't out for the '02's yet, FWIW. Being an A4, your next mod should be a torque converter! It's the absolute best mod you can do for an auto, and with the right one you can easily reduce your 1/4 ET's by .5+ while retaining excellent streetability. There's a ton of info on various torque converters in the drivetrain section. I'd recommend doing a search.

I second that, torque converter should definitely be next. When I put the Super Yank 3500 in, I gained .4 in the quarter. When I swapped to a Yank Pro Thruster 4000 I gained an additional .2 in the quarter for a total of .6 over stock.
